One of the most vital pieces of pharma lab equipment is a spectrophotometer. This device is used to measure the concentration of a substance in a sample by measuring the amount of light absorbed by the sample. Spectrophotometers are essential in pharmaceutical laboratories for accurately determining the purity of raw materials, monitoring the progress of chemical reactions, and analyzing the final products for quality control purposes. Without spectrophotometers, pharmaceutical companies would struggle to ensure the consistency and potency of their products.

Another crucial piece of pharma lab equipment is a high-performance liquid chromatography (HPLC) system. HPLC systems are used to separate, identify, and quantify the individual components of a sample. This is particularly important in pharmaceutical research and development, where scientists need to analyze complex mixtures of compounds to ensure the safety and effectiveness of a drug. HPLC systems are also used for quality control purposes, allowing pharmaceutical companies to detect impurities and ensure that their products meet the strict regulatory standards set by health authorities.

In addition to spectrophotometers and HPLC systems, pharmaceutical laboratories also rely on other types of equipment such as mass spectrometers, dissolution testers, and stability chambers. Mass spectrometers are used to analyze the chemical composition of a sample by ionizing the molecules and measuring their mass-to-charge ratios. Dissolution testers are used to assess the rate at which a drug dissolves in a simulated physiological fluid, providing valuable insights into its bioavailability and efficacy. Stability chambers are used to test the long-term stability of pharmaceutical products under various environmental conditions, ensuring that they remain safe and effective throughout their shelf life.
